First impression? The box is classic, and the shoe itself—wow. That black patent leather cut against the white mesh and that icy sole? It's just a clean, timeless silhouette. The build quality feels solid right out of the box. For $225, you expect this level of presentation, and Jordan Brand delivered here. Now, potential cons? The patent leather can crease, and it's pretty noticeable. If you're super worried about keeping your kicks pristine, that might bug you. Also, the fit can be narrow for some—if you have wide feet, maybe consider going up half a size. At $225 USD, it's a significant investment for a retro model with tech that's decades old.
